次の方法で共有

Access2016 更新プログラム実行後のADO処理の不具合について

Anonymous
2020-06-18T13:50:18+00:00

Accessの更新プログラム実行後に、ADO処理に不具合が発生するようになりました。

Access 2016 MSO (16.0.12827.20200) 32ビット

windows10

参照設定 :【microsoft activex data objects 2.8 library】

下記プログラムでのコンパイルは正常処理されます。

CurrentProject.Connectionの所でフリーズして、バックアップファイル作成のファイルダイアログが開きます。

データベースの最適化/修復を実行しても改善されません。

他のAccessファイルで作成したプログラムも同じ所でフリーズします。

Public Sub ADOSET02()     

    Dim cn As New ADODB.Connection

    Dim rs As New ADODB.Recordset

    Dim strTbl As String

    Set cn = CurrentProject.Connection  ← ここでフリーズします。

    strTbl = "SELECT * FROM dbo_T_1"  

    With rs

        .Open strTbl, cn, adOpenKeyset, adLockOptimistic, adCmdTableDirect       

        Do Until .EOF

以下省略

Microsoft 365 と Office | アクセス | 家庭向け | Windows

ロックされた質問。 この質問は、Microsoft サポート コミュニティから移行されました。 役に立つかどうかに投票することはできますが、コメントの追加、質問への返信やフォローはできません。

0 件のコメント コメントはありません

2 件の回答

並べ替え方法: 最も役に立つ
  1. Anonymous
    2020-06-19T11:28:47+00:00

    Makapuさん、こんにちは。

    貴重な情報をありがとうございます。

    更新プログラムによる不具合は、他の方でも起きているようですね。

    私の場合は、3月末の更新プログラム(自動更新)が実行されてから不具合がでるようになりました。

    当初は、Accessアプリが壊れたと思い再インストールしたらプログラムが正常に処理できるようになりました。その後、直ぐに更新プログラムを実行したら、また同様の不具合が発生したため、更新プログラムのバグだと気付きました。

    更新プログラムの改善を期待して、定期的に更新プログラムを試しているのですが、未だ改善されていないようです。

    この回答は役に立ちましたか?

    0 件のコメント コメントはありません
  2. Makapu 92,110 評価のポイント ボランティア モデレーター
    2020-06-18T22:30:40+00:00

    tomohisa_mさん、こんにちは。

    以下のスレッドでも 6月の更新プログラムで不具合が起きておりますが、ADO ですので症状が異なるようですね。

    ACCESSが強制終了される

    以前のバージョンにロールバックしてどうか確認していてはいかがでしょうか。

    以前のバージョンの Office に戻す方法

    この回答は役に立ちましたか?

    0 件のコメント コメントはありません